The Importance of Proper Anchoring for 12-Foot Power Poles


Power poles play a vital role in our modern electrical infrastructure, carrying electricity to homes, businesses, and essential services. Among various power pole sizes, 12-foot power poles are commonly used, especially in residential areas and rural settings where power distribution requires lower heights. However, the effectiveness and safety of these power poles rely heavily on how well they are anchored in the ground. Proper anchoring methods mitigate risks such as pole movement, leaning, or even complete failure during high winds or storms.


Understanding Power Poles and Their Use


A 12-foot power pole is typically made from materials such as wood or metal, designed to withstand environmental forces while providing support for electrical lines. These poles are strategically placed to optimize the distribution of electrical service, ensuring minimal disruption and maximum efficiency. However, their height, while practical for many applications, poses unique challenges. Its relatively low elevation makes it susceptible to toppling, particularly in adverse weather conditions. This is where proper anchoring becomes crucial.


The Basics of Anchoring


Anchoring involves securing the pole to the ground using various methods that enhance stability. This is typically achieved through the use of anchor rods, guy wires, or ties that are buried deep into the ground or attached to the pole in a manner that redistributes the forces acting upon it. The depth and type of anchoring can vary based on local soil conditions, pole height, and wind loads.


For 12-foot poles, the anchoring must provide enough strength to counteract lateral forces. This requires careful calculations and considerations, often relying on engineering principles to determine the appropriate size and material of anchors. The anchoring system must be robust enough to withstand forces generated by wind, ice accumulation, and even the weight of electrical lines themselves.


Types of Anchors


There are several types of anchors used for power poles, each with its unique advantages

1. Concrete Anchors These are often the strongest and are used in locations prone to high winds. A concrete block is buried underground, and the pole is secured to it with heavy-duty bolts or cables.


2. Steel Rods Steel rods are driven into the ground and then connected to the power pole through brackets or clamps. They provide significant resistance against lateral forces but may require more maintenance over time.


3. Guy Wires Guy wires are cables that stretch from the pole to the ground, creating a triangular structure that enhances stability. They are commonly used for taller poles but can also be effective for shorter 12-foot poles, particularly in areas with high wind.


4. Burying the Pole In some cases, the base of the pole can be buried several feet in the ground to provide a natural anchor. This method is simple but requires proper soil conditions to ensure effectiveness.


Maintenance of Anchors


Once installed, it’s crucial to regularly inspect the anchoring system. Over time, the soil can shift, anchors can corrode, and harsh weather can impact the integrity of anchoring materials. Scheduled checks ensure that any issues can be addressed before they lead to significant problems, such as pole failure or electrical hazards.
